Tax Basketing for a 72(t) Payment Plan

Some retiring in their 50s will need to use a 72(t) payment plan. This often involves establishing a “72(t) IRA” and a “non-72(t) IRA.”

People wonder “how do you allocate your portfolio when you have a 72(t) payment plan?”

Below we tackle 72(t) IRAs from a tax basketing perspective. Most investors in the financial independence community want some allocation to bonds and some to equities.* Thus, questions emerge for those employing a 72(t) payment plan: what should be in my 72(t) IRA? What should be in my non-72(t) IRA?

72(t) Example

Monty, age 53, has a $2M traditional 401(k), $10,000 in a savings account, and a paid off house. He wants to retire and take his first annual $80,000 72(t) payment in February 2023. Monty also wants to have a 75/25 equity/bond allocation. 

First, Monty would need to transfer his 401(k) to a traditional IRA (preferably through a direct trustee-to-trustee transfer).

Once the 401(k) is in the traditional IRA, Monty needs to split his traditional IRA into two traditional IRAs, one being the 72(t) IRA (out of which he takes the annual 72(t) payment) and one being the non-72(t) IRA. 

To determine the size of the 72(t) IRA, Monty uses the commonly used fixed amortization method and decides to pick the following numbers: 

  • Maximum allowable interest rate, 5.79%, 
  • The Single Life Table factor for age 53 (33.4), and 
  • The annual payment he’s selected, $80,000. 

With those three numbers, Monty can do a calculation (see IRS Q&A 7 and my YouTube video on the calculation) and determine that the 72(t) IRA should be $1,170,848.59. Thus, the non-72(t) IRA should be $829,151.41.

72(t) Portfolio Allocation

How does Monty allocate the 72(t) IRA and the non-72(t) IRA such that (1) his overall financial asset portfolio ties out to the desired 75/25 allocation and (2) he is as tax optimized as possible. 

I believe that Monty should aim to keep his 72(t) IRA as small as possible. Why? Because it is possible that Monty will not need his 72(t) payment at some point prior to turning age 59 ½. 

Perhaps Monty inherits $300,000 when he is age 57. At that point, he can use that money to fund his lifestyle until age 59 ½. Why does he want to keep paying taxes on the $80,000 annual 72(t) payment?

Monty has an option available: a one-time change of the 72(t) payment to the RMD method. If Monty switches to the RMD method, he’s likely to dramatically reduce the annual amount of the required 72(t) payment. The RMD method keys off the account balance at the end of the prior year. The lower the balance, the lower the required annual payment under the RMD method. 

Since Monty has decided to invest in equities and bonds, I believe that Monty should house his bonds inside his 72(t) IRA. While there are absolutely no guarantees when it comes to investment returns, equities tend to grow more than bonds. Since bonds tend to be lower growth, they are a great candidate for the 72(t) IRA.

It would stink if Monty wanted to reduce his annual 72(t) payment only to find that a 72(t) IRA composed entirely of equities had skyrocketed in value, increasing the amount of his revised annual payment under the RMD method. 

Thus, I believe that Monty should put his entire bond allocation, $500,000, inside his 72(t) IRA. That makes the rest of the tax basketing easy: have the entire non 72(t) IRA be invested in equities, and have the remainder of his 72(t) IRA, $670,849, be invested in equities.

72(t), Sequence of Returns Risk, and Safe Withdrawal Rate

One must remember that 72(t) is entirely a tax concept. At least in theory, it has nothing to do with sequence of returns risk and safe withdrawal rate. 

Some might look at the 72(t) IRA, $1,170,848.59, and say “Wait a minute: an $80K withdrawal is way more than 4% or 5% of that 72(t) IRA! Isn’t this a dangerous withdrawal rate? Doesn’t this amplify the sequence of returns risk?”

Remember, Monty’s withdrawal rate is $80,000 divided by the entire $2M portfolio (4%), not $80,000 divided by the $1,170,848.59 72(t) IRA. Further, Monty’s sequence of returns risk on this withdrawal rate exists regardless of the 72(t) plan. The greater the overall withdrawal rate, the greater the sequence of returns risk.

Lastly, the 5.79% interest rate Monty chooses has nothing to do with the withdrawal rate. It has everything to do with keeping the size of the 72(t) IRA as small as possible. The chosen interest rate doesn’t change the amount of the annual withdrawal ($80,000) but rather changes the size of the 72(t) IRA.

Conclusion

Tax basketing should be considered when crafting a 72(t) payment plan. I generally believe that investments that are less likely to have substantial gains sit better inside an investor’s 72(t) IRA rather than their non-72(t) IRA.
